Key Takeaways

  • The pancreas is a critical organ located behind the stomach that manages both digestion and metabolism.
  • It produces powerful enzymes that break down proteins, fats, and carbohydrates for nutrient absorption.
  • This organ regulates blood sugar levels by secreting essential hormones like insulin and glucagon.
  • Maintaining pancreatic health is vital for preventing metabolic complications and supporting longevity.

Anatomical Location and Structural Overview

The pancreas is a special gland in our belly, behind the stomach. It’s in a great spot to help the small intestine. Knowing where it is helps us see how it helps with digestion every day.

The pancreas has different parts, like the head, body, and tail. It does two main jobs: making hormones and breaking down nutrients. This makes it a very versatile organ.

The Exocrine Function: The Powerhouse of Digestion

About 90% of the pancreas is exocrine. This part is the main worker, making digestive juices. When we talk about the pancreas’s role in digestion, we’re talking about this part.

The pancreas makes enzymes that go to the small intestine. These enzymes break down nutrients into something our bodies can use. Without them, we wouldn’t get energy from food.

We divide these enzymes into three main types: amylase, lipase, and proteases. Each one plays a special role in breaking down different nutrients. Knowing what enzymes does pancreas produce helps us understand how digestion works.

Amylase and Carbohydrate Breakdown

When you eat starchy foods, your body needs special helpers to start breaking them down. Pancreatic amylase digests complex carbs into simple sugars like glucose. This is key because your cells need these sugars for energy.

You might wonder, what does pancreatic amylase do? It turns heavy starches into smaller molecules that your small intestine can absorb. Without it, your body would have trouble getting energy from foods like grains and potatoes.

Lipase and the Digestion of Dietary Fats

Fats are hard for the body to process without the right help. You might ask, what organ produces lipase to handle fats? The pancreas makes this enzyme, which works with bile to break down fats into fatty acids and glycerol.

This process is key for absorbing fat-soluble vitamins like A, D, E, and K. Thanks to these enzymes released by the pancreas, your body can use fats for hormone production and cell health.

Proteases and Protein Hydrolysis

Proteins are the building blocks of your body. Proteases, enzymes from the pancreas, break down proteins into amino acids. These enzymes are vital for repairing tissues and supporting your immune system.

The Journey of Pancreatic Juices to the Small Intestine

The way pancreatic secretions move into the digestive system is amazing. Every day, your pancreas makes about 8 ounces of special fluid. These pancreatic juices aid digestion and absorption by breaking down food into energy.

The Role of Pancreatic Ducts and the Duodenum

The pancreatic digestive juices are carried by tiny tubes called pancreatic ducts. These ducts merge into a main duct that goes straight to the duodenum, the small intestine’s first part.

When the fluid gets there, it mixes well with the food from the stomach. This ensures the enzymes work best where they’re needed most.

Neutralizing Stomach Acid with Sodium Bicarbonate

Food from the stomach is very acidic. This could harm the small intestine’s lining. So, the pancreas adds sodium bicarbonate to its digestive enzymes.

This alkaline substance acts as a natural buffer. It makes the environment safer for the intestinal wall by neutralizing stomach acid.

Optimizing the Environment for Nutrient Absorption

The pancreatic enzymes digestion process works best in a neutral environment. Most enzymes need a certain pH to work well. The pancreas adjusts the acidity to help these enzymes break down nutrients.

With the right pH, the body can get vitamins, minerals, and energy from food. This is key for staying healthy and full of energy.

FAQ

What is the role of the pancreas in the human body?

The pancreas is a vital organ that supports both digestion and blood sugar regulation. It produces digestive enzymes and hormones like insulin and glucagon to help process food and maintain glucose balance.

What enzymes does the pancreas produce to assist in breaking down food?

The pancreas produces enzymes such as amylase, lipase, and proteases (like trypsin and chymotrypsin). These enzymes break down carbohydrates, fats, and proteins respectively.

What does pancreatic amylase do during the digestive process?

Pancreatic amylase breaks down complex carbohydrates into simpler sugars like maltose and glucose. This process mainly occurs in the small intestine.

What organ produces lipase for fat digestion?

The pancreas produces lipase, which is the main enzyme responsible for breaking down dietary fats. It helps convert fats into fatty acids and glycerol for absorption.

How do pancreatic juices aid digestion and absorption of nutrients?

Pancreatic juices contain enzymes and bicarbonate, which neutralize stomach acid and create an optimal environment for digestion. This allows efficient breakdown and absorption of nutrients in the small intestine.

How are pancreatic digestive juices carried to the small intestine?

Pancreatic juices are transported through the pancreatic duct into the duodenum, the first part of the small intestine. This ensures enzymes are delivered directly where digestion continues.
